проверить / загрузить изображения в папку домена с субдомена - PullRequest
2 голосов
/ 12 ноября 2010

У меня есть домен www.mysite.com и поддомен api1.mysite.com. Там (в домене) есть несколько папок и папок "images". Также есть папка api1, которая является папкой субдомена. Что я не могу понять, так это как найти в поддомене папку «картинки» домиана и загрузить туда файлы или проверить, существуют ли они. Я использую php. например,

эта строка находится в одном из файлов в папке поддоменов, а папка «images» на один уровень выше - в папке домена.

$dir_img_small = file_exists('images/users/small/i_'.$profile_id.'.jpg');

Я пытался использовать ../ перед изображениями, но это не сработало. Пожалуйста, помогите!

СПАСИБО ВСЕМ! Я решил это сам. ДОБАВЛЕНО ../../www В ПЕРЕДНЕМ ИЗОБРАЖЕНИИ. ОБРАТИТЕ ВНИМАНИЕ НА УТВЕРЖДЕНИЕ ДОМАШНЕГО КАТАЛОГА, И ЭТО РАБОТАЛО.

Ответы [ 2 ]

1 голос
/ 12 ноября 2010

Возможно, вам следует попытаться указать полный путь к каталогу:

$root_path = "enter root path here/";
$dir_img_small = file_exists($root_path . 'images/users/small/i_'.$profile_id.'.jpg');
0 голосов
/ 12 ноября 2010

Если вы используете IIS, вы можете определить «виртуальную» папку на одном веб-сайте, которая указывает на физическую папку где-то на сервере.

Таким образом, вы можете определить виртуальную папку с именем images и сопоставить ее с физической папкой, которая является той же папкой, что и папка с изображениями другого сайта.

...